Orico ClearLink M.2 DIY 2TB Moveable SSD overview: specs, efficiency, price


Orico ClearLink SSD overview – some meeting required.




Everybody wants extra digital storage today, particularly as file sizes proceed to develop and firms provide gadgets with criminally low quantities to start with. Orico’s ClearLink M.2 2TB DIY moveable SSD offers an answer with an SSD drive and enclosure duo that gives a very good, however not nice, bang in your buck.

The Orico ClearLink 2TB DIY SSD affords a smooth and moveable design with sufficient storage capability for nearly everybody, from photographers to screenwriters. It has switch speeds quick sufficient for giant information, however the USB-C assist could also be limiting for essentially the most excessive customers, and the clear plastic enclosure is susceptible to scratches, making it higher suited to at-home or in-office use.

The Orico ClearLink 2TB DIY SSD is a two-part SSD drive with the enclosure bought individually from the J-10 solid-state drive, or as a bundle, just like the unit we examined. The separate enclosure makes it potential to swap out NVMe drives, if wanted, or to benefit from greater switch speeds.

We unboxed the stable state drive first, which is the Orico J-10 PCIe 3.0 NVMe M.2 2TB SSD drive that you could set up in quite a lot of machines, together with PC towers. In our case, we paired it with Orico’s ClearLink M.2 SSD enclosure, which is tool-free and USB-C supported.

Within the field, the J-10 comes with a few heatsink pads and metallic plates for the varied potential configurations. We used solely considered one of every for our testing, because the enclosure solely has sufficient area for one.

We respect the inclusion of a number of heatsinks and the easy set up. The circuitry on the J-10 drive can be polished, scratch and tarnish-free, and the supplies look high-quality, giving us a constructive first impression.

The enclosure additionally comes packaged with warmth sinks, giving us additional simply in case. It additionally has a brief 12-inch USB-C cable with aluminum plug housings and a wire gauge thicker than our MacBook Professional’s charging cable.

The a part of the enclosure that homes the electronics comes housed in aluminum, however the remainder of the enclosure is evident plastic paying homage to the late 90s and early 2000s. Whereas we benefit from the aesthetic, particularly the glowing LED indicator lights, the housing is vulnerable to scratches, particularly when used portably.

There’s not a lot to overlook with the Orico ClearLink DIY Moveable SSD, as there are only a few elements, no buttons or dials, and one port for connecting the drive to gadgets. It has a smooth kind issue, taking on much less area than even compact USB-C docks.

First impressions are promising, even when the enclosure attracts scuffs.

Splitting the Orico ClearLink M.2 SSD enclosure is easy, consisting of sliding the highest half away from the remainder of the housing. Then, to put in the J-10 drive, line up the connector pins, slide the drive into the port and safe it with a rubber pin.

The J-10 SSD is an M-key interface kind, and the enclosure additionally helps B+M key SATA-based drives, permitting SSDs of as much as 4TB. After putting in the drive, the highest half slides again into place with an honest snap.

Whereas the ClearLink M.2’s design would not require the usage of instruments, promising a stress-free set up, there’s a little play aspect to aspect and prime to backside between the 2 elements of the enclosure. The separation of elements is not detrimental for at-home or in-office use, nevertheless it does imply the ClearLink 2TB DIY SSD is not as strong as rugged alternate options.

Connecting the ClearLink SSD to our MacBook Professional was additionally a straight shot to the USB-C port, with no adapter or something in between. Nonetheless, when utilizing any new exterior exhausting drive, we needed to format it to work accurately with our laptop.

Fortunately, the macOS software program makes it straightforward to format and even walks you thru the steps to set it up as a Time Machine backup drive in case you plan on utilizing the ClearLink SSD for that function. After formatting, we have been pleasantly stunned on the obtainable capability of two.05TB, whereas different drives we now have utilized are sometimes lower than full capability.

Whereas Orico has different drives with Thunderbolt assist, this specific mannequin, the ClearLink M.2 enclosure, charges as solely a USB-C 3.2 with switch speeds of as much as 10Gb/s. Nonetheless, this built-it-yourself enclosure is available in at a significantly better worth per TB than pre-fabricated exterior drives.

Certainly, Orico enclosures are solely about $15-$25, and the drive sells for round $100 on the 2TB degree. In actuality, until you are future-proofing your setup or constructing a strong backup system, spending big quantities of cash on a Thunderbolt 4 drive makes much less sense, as USB-C 3.2 speeds are often quick sufficient for many customers.

In apply, we use an M1 MacBook Professional with wherever from 5 to 10 functions open at any given time. We do not have particular tools or environments — primarily, we function underneath on a regular basis situations.

Utilizing the Orico ClearLink 2TB DIY SSD in these circumstances produces favorable outcomes. As an illustration, we have been in a position to switch a large 9.58GB file containing greater than 600 RAW and JPEG photographs in solely 18 seconds, which exhibits the time financial savings potential for picture and video modifying.

For comparability, that very same file took almost 4 minutes to switch between a high-speed SD card and a MacBook Professional. Likewise, the switch took virtually six minutes when utilizing a disk-based exterior exhausting drive.

Naturally, we needed to get extra exact measurements of pace, so we downloaded the Black Magic disk pace take a look at app. Utilizing the utmost 5GB load, we acquired the Orico ClearLink 2TB DIY SSD to hit a median of 837MB/s learn speeds and 807MB/s write speeds.

In contrast with the aforementioned SD card, which could not even muster 100MB/s, the Orico SSD carried out leaps and bounds quicker. To not point out, the interior SSD drive on our MacBook is not too far forward, with speeds of simply over 2,900MB/s learn and 1,600MB/s write.

These outcomes have been utilizing real-world situations, and the outcomes you obtain could fluctuate relying on a lot of elements. These elements embrace the processor of your machine, the area remaining on the SSD and inside storage drives, the kinds of information transferred, and even the temperature of your workstation.

Orico’s ClearLink 2TB DIY SSD has a skinny and low-profile design, making it moveable sufficient to take to the workplace, library, or round the home. It affords fast switch charges, particularly when up towards different storage choices, like SD playing cards or disk-based exhausting drives.

The Orico ClearLink 2TB DIY SSD is simple to assemble and requires no instruments or specialised data. Likewise, pairing it with a MacBook Professional for the primary time was easy, and we unlocked greater than 2TB price of storage.

Regardless of being a transportable SSD resolution, as a result of the Orico ClearLink DIY SSD depends on detachable elements, it is much less strong than different exterior storage gadgets. The plastic enclosure may also scratch and scuff, which takes away from the cool retro design.

General, the Orico ClearLink 2TB DIY SSD does what it guarantees, however we’d advocate utilizing it at residence or within the workplace to guard it from injury. The DIY nature results in vulnerabilities that may trigger injury in case you determine to move it too often.
